CITY OF CARMEL-BY-THE-SEA

Council Report
August 4, 2015
To:

Honorable Mayor, Members of the City Council,


Douglas J. Schmitz, City Administrator

From:

Janet Bombard, Library and Community Activities Director

Subject:

Consideration of a resolution authorizing: 1. An event on Saturday,


October 24, 2015 honoring the Centennial Anniversary of the Carmel-bythe-Sea Fire Department and 2: The closure of Mission Street between
Ocean and 6th Avenues, and 6th Avenue between Mission and San
Carlos Streets in conjunction with said event

RECOMMENDATION(S):
Adopt a resolution authorizing the event and the closure of streets in conjunction with said
event
EXECUTIVE SUMMARY:
July 1, 2015 marked the 100th year anniversary of the Carmel-by-the-Sea Fire Department.
City of Carmel-by-the-Sea Community Activities staff, together with the Carmel Police
Department, Monterey Fire Department, and the Monterey Firefighters Association, wish to
hold an event on Saturday, October 24, 2015 from noon to 3:00 p.m. to commemorate and
celebrate this important piece of the Citys history.
The event will take place inside the fire station, in Devendorf Park, on Mission Street between
Ocean and 6th Avenues, and on 6th Avenue between Mission and San Carlos Streets. The
event will require closure of the aforementioned streets from 8:00 a.m. to 5:30 p.m., which
requires authorization by the City Council.
ANALYSIS/DISCUSSION:
The purpose of the event is twofold: to honor the centennial anniversary of the Carmel-bythe-Sea Fire Department, and to recognize the firefighters who have served the City
throughout the departments 100-year history.
The event will begin at noon with a ceremony recognizing past firefighters, fire chiefs and fire
marshals. Historical uniforms, photographs, memorabilia, and equipment including old fire
hoses, a hose cart, the 1951 Police Department patrol car, and the 1923 LuVerne fire engine
will be on display in fire station bays and on 6th Avenue.
The Monterey Fire Department Safety Trailer, which teaches children how to identify and
what to do in case of a fire will also be set up on 6th Avenue. Other activities for children

will include a Kids' Firefighter Challenge I Obstacle Course in Devendorf Park and face
painting. Firefighter hats will be handed out to youth attending the event, and depending on
the fire season, Smokey the Bear may also be present to greet and speak with the kids.
The Fire Department intends to prepare and serve hot dogs, popcorn and water at the event.
The hot dogs will be cooked in the fire station kitchen and handed out in the park and on the
street.
Because a portion of Devendorf Park will be used for the event, staff is requesting permission
to close Mission Street between Ocean and 6th Avenues. The street closure will connect
Devendorf Park to the event, and provide a safe way for event attendees to cross to the park.
Staff is also requesting permission to close 6th Avenue in front of the Fire Station between
Mission and San Carlos Streets for the purpose of displaying historic equipment and setting
up the Monterey Fire Department Safety Trailer.
Setup for the event will begin at 8:00 a.m., the event will run from noon to 3:00 p.m., and
teardown will take place from 3:00 to 5:30p.m.
Should Council approve the event, staff will coordinate the rerouting of public buses during
the event with Monterey Salinas Transit {MST).
